4 of 12:  Wave of the Future:  Juan Encarnacion - Tigers

Woah, a baseball card with a watery-goo like substance inside it?  Definitely the Wave of the Future!   As crazy and weird as cards like this are, it was a big part of what makes late '90s boxes so much fun to open...you really never quite know just what to expect!  That's completely unlike sets like today's flagship Topps where you can pretty name each type of insert just by looking at the previous year's set.
